About Plas Johnson

Plas John Johnson Jr. () (July 21, 1931 – July 15, 2026) was an American soul-jazz and hard bop tenor saxophonist, probably most widely known as the tenor saxophone soloist on Henry Mancini’s "The Pink Panther Theme". He also performed on alto and baritone sax as well as various flutes and clarinets. == Life and career == Plas John Johnson Jr. was born in Donaldsonville, Louisiana, United States on July 21, 1931. He sang with his family's group until his saxophonist father bought him a soprano saxophone. Largely self-taught, he soon began playing alto and later tenor saxophone. He and his pianist brother Ray first recorded as the Johnson Brothers in New Orleans in the late 1940s. He first toured with R&B singer Charles Brown in 1951. After serving in the U.S. Army during the Korean War, he and his brother moved to Los Angeles in 1954, and he soon began session recordings as a full-time musician, backing artists such as B.B. King and Johnny Otis as well as scores of other R&B performers.
